요약Prior literature in exergame research suggests that exergaming could improve cognitive function in older adults, yet what types of exergames would contribute to cognitive improvement have not been fully identified. This dissertation seeks to inv
요약In a 2 (levels of immersion: high vs. low) x 2 (types of task load: task-relevant vs. task-irrelevant) between-subjects experimental design, participants were randomly assigned into one of four conditions and asked to play an exergame (Fruit Nin
요약The results of repeated-measures analysis of covariance (ANCOVAs) revealed a significant interaction effect of immersion x time for cognitive flexibility and inhibitory control, with an improvement in the high-immersion condition over the course
요약These findings suggested that spatial presence, elicited by the immersive virtual reality, was involved in a cognitive process, which later led to an improved performance in inhibitory control and cognitive flexibility. This study also demonstra
